Happy IPL from Airtel – free upgrade to 2mbps for all

Starting today, all IPL matches will be broadcast live around the world through Youtube. Well that is a known story. Now Airtel joins the party by announcing that all broadband connections will be upgraded to 2mbps for the entire duration of the IPL and it’s free of charge.
